В статье представлен вариант реализации генетического алгоритма для автоматизации составления расписания, требования к которому условно разделены на обязательные и желательные. Раскрыта идея учета обязательных условий на этапе создания особи, что экономит время на их оценку и отбор. Необязательные условия учитываются с помощью функции штрафов. Приведены примеры реализации алгоритма в виде кода на С++.
Лагоша А.М. 1, Карелова Р.А. 2 ВАРИАНТ РЕАЛИЗАЦИИ ГЕНЕТИЧЕСКОГО АЛГОРИТМА В РЕШЕНИИ ЗАДАЧИ СОСТАВЛЕНИЯ РАСПИСАНИЯ // Наука и перспективы. – 2021. – № 3;
URL: nip.esrae.ru/40-298 (дата обращения:
25.12.2024).